Biography
Jim Anderson is an internationally recognized recording engineer and producer for acoustic music in the recording, radio, television, and film industries. He is the recipient of numerous awards and nominations in the recording industry, including nine Grammy-awarded recordings and 25 Grammy-nominated recordings, as well as two George Foster Peabody Awards for radio programs and two Emmy nominations for television programs. He has been a frequent lecturer and master-class guest faculty member at leading international institutes, including the Berklee School of Music; Peabody School of Music; McGill University; Banff Centre of the Arts; Universitaet der Kuenste Berlin; University of LuleƄ, PiteƄ Sweden; The New School; Penn State University; Tokyo National University of the Arts, University of Surrey, among others. He was the Eastern U.S. and Canadian Vice President of the Audio Engineering Society, has chaired many AES Conventions, was made a Fellow of the AES and was President of the AES, 2008-2009. Jim was Chair of the Clive Davis Department of Recorded Music 2004-2008.
